If the two things you are wanting to change are components in an assembly, you could change how they are shown in a drawing by changing their component display setting, via
Layout->Component Display
It will ask you to select parts. Pick them, using <Ctrl> - Left Mouse Button to pick more than one, then center mouse button. Then you pick the type of display you want for the selected components. Try different ones and see which suits you best - looks like you might want PhantomOpque (for Phantom lines, opaque geometry).
This is a handy method to blank components in one view, or change how a part looks if it is being shown in a tooling drawing, etc.
